Title :
Design of a real-time monitoring system for transmission line galloping based on GPRS/CDMA

Abstract :
According to the analysis of both advantages and disadvantages of various monitoring systems, a real-time monitoring system for transmission line´s galloping based on GPRS/CDMA is developed in this paper. On one hand, measured data is used to modify the simulation model and calculation parameters to avoid empty theoretic study and deficiency of calculation precision. On the other hand, deficient monitoring point and measured data which is hard to gain due to lower occurrence probability in the extreme meteorologic conditions can be compensated via simulation. Corrected and accurate simulation model combining with weather forecast and measured data can issue a warning ahead of time for the operation security of transmission lines.
